OVERALL PURPOSE

The Retail Administrator & Project Lead plays a critical role in enabling the success, scale, and consistency of Bullfrog Spas Factory Stores. This role supports the retail strategy by ensuring highly organized execution of day-to-day operations, cross-functional initiatives, and current and future retail projects across all Factory Store markets.

This position acts as the central coordination hub for retail initiatives-bridging leadership, store teams, vendors, and internal departments-while providing administrative excellence, project management discipline, and hands-on retail support when needed. The role ensures that priorities are clear, timelines are met, communication flows effectively, and execution standards are upheld.

RESPONSIBLE FOR

  • Supporting retail leadership and store teams through strong administrative, project, and operational coordination
  • Driving clarity, accountability, and follow-through across retail initiatives
  • Coordinating execution across all Factory Store markets to support performance targets, consistency, and growth
  • Ensuring retail projects are planned, documented, communicated, tracked, and delivered on time and within scope
  • Acting as a trusted liaison between leadership, store teams, vendors, and internal partners

 

KEY D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

  1. Retail Operations & Administrative Support
  • Provide day-to-day administrative and operational support to retail leadership and store teams
  • Plan, schedule, and coordinate meetings, training sessions, events, store visits, and off-site initiatives
  • Prepare agendas, document meeting minutes, and translate discussions into clear action items with owners and due dates
  • Track follow-ups and ensure commitments are completed
  • Manage travel arrangements, hotel bookings, meals, and logistics for leadership and retail teams
  • Order and manage office, store, and training supplies

 

  1. Project & Program Management
  • Coordinate retail projects and initiatives from planning through execution and close-out
  • Develop and maintain project timelines, milestones, and deliverables
  • Monitor progress across teams, identify risks or delays, and proactively escalate issues
  • Ensure proj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to defined standards
  • Support new store openings, remodels, system rollouts, retail pilots, and operational improvements
  • Collect feedback from stakeholders and end users to assess effectiveness and identify improvement opportunities

 

  1. Cross-Functional & Vendor Coordination
  • Serve as a liaison between retail, finance, marketing, operations, service, IT, and external partners
  • Coordinate with vendors and contractors regarding timelines, deliverables, documentation, and readiness
  • Ensure projects and operations align with company policies, procedures, and compliance requirements
  • Support vendor communication related to POP, signage, store materials, systems, and events

 

  1. Retail Financial & Documentation Support
  • Prepare and organize documents supporting retail financial processes, including:
  • Budgets and forecasts
  • Proformas and CapEx requests
  • Store opening documentation
  • Financing, POS, and spa transaction support
  • Track deadlines and documentation requirements to ensure timely submissions and approvals
  • Support data gathering and basic analysis to assist leadership decision-making

 

  1. Training, Performance & Team Support
  • Assist with onboarding, training coordination, and ongoing development initiatives
  • Support performance management processes including feedback cycles, documentation, and review coordination
  • Help ensure retail standards, processes, and expectations are clearly communicated and reinforced
  • Act as a trusted point of contact for team members when questions, issues, or concerns arise
  • Support off-site events with planning, logistics, POP ordering, and administrative execution

 

  1. 6. Planning, Reporting & Continuous Improvement
  • Set and manage daily, weekly, monthly, and quarterly priorities aligned with retail goals
  • Maintain trackers, dashboards, and documentation to improve visibility and accountability
  • Identify process gaps, inefficiencies, or risks and propose practical improvements
  • Support continuous improvement initiatives focused on retail execution, communication, and scalability
